Comments on the production information

  • PRODUCTS A & B ARE THE COMBINED PEBBLE AND CONCENTRATE PRODUCT. THE AVERAGE PEBBLE PRODUCT IS 30% OF TOTAL OUTPUT AND FLOAT CONCENTRATE IS 70% OF TOTAL OUTPUT.
  • PRODUCTION GIVEN IN BUR. OF MINES STATS EXCEPT FOR 1984: COMPANY GAVE 1984 PRODUCTION OF PRODUCT. UPDATED IN 1994 TO 3.5M MT ROCK PRODUCT.

Comments on the reserve resource information

  • ALL TONNAGES AND GRADES BASED ON DRY IN-SITU DENSITY.
  • ADIT UPDATE 1994: MINING IN THE NORTH PASTURE PROPERTY IS NOW ENDED. COMPANY IS NOW CONSTRUCTING WASHING PLANT AT SOUTH PASTURE PROPERTY THAT WILL PRODUCE 3.5 MILLION TONS PRODUCT PER YEAR. MINE WILL COMMENCE OPERATING IN SEPTEMBER 1995.
